A former compelling president of the Foreign Correspondents' Club of Japan, Bob was elected this last June the club's first "kanji." He explained, "This is variously translated as 'auditor' or 'ombudsman' to serve as a watchdog over the board of directors on behalf of the general membership." A recent Japanese regulation requires each organization with the status of FCCJ to have an elected kanji.
